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import random
- random.seed = 1
- n = 100
- list1 = list()
- list2 = list()
- E1 = 0
- E2 = 0
- z=0
- for _ in range(n):
- tmp = round(random.randint(1, 17) * random.random(),2)
- list1.append(tmp)
- list2.append(pow(tmp, 2))
- E1 += tmp
- E2 += pow(tmp, 2)
- if tmp<=10:
- z+=1
- else:
- E1 /= n
- E2 /= n
- # print("list1:", *list1, sep='\n')
- # print("list2:", *list2, sep='\n')
- for i in range(n):
- print(f"list1: {list1[i]} list2: {list2[i]}", sep=';')
- print(f"\nE_ksi={E1}, E_ksi^2={E2}")
- print(f"D={E2-pow(E1,2)}")
- print(f"[0,10]:{z}")
- tmp1= sorted(list(map(lambda x: str(x), list1)))
- variation = [float(item) for item in tmp1]
- print(variation)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ement